A breast lift (mastopexy) is performed to reshape and reposition sagging breasts, creating a more youthful and balanced appearance. While many patients are satisfied with their results, some experience concerns about their breast shape after mastopexy, especially when the final appearance does not match their expectations.
Breast shape after a lift can change during the healing process. Early swelling, tightness, and tissue positioning may temporarily affect appearance before the breasts settle into their final form.
Common breast shape concerns after mastopexy include:
- Breasts looking too flat
- Breasts appearing boxy or square
- Loss of upper breast fullness
- Breasts looking smaller than expected
- Uneven breast shape
- Breasts appearing too tight or unnatural
- Lack of roundness or projection
The final breast appearance depends on several factors, including breast tissue quality, surgical technique, skin elasticity, breast size, and whether implants or fat grafting were used.

What Should Breast Shape Look Like After Mastopexy?
Expected Breast Appearance After Healing
A successful breast lift usually creates:
- Higher breast position
- Improved breast contour
- Better nipple placement
- Firmer breast shape
- More youthful proportions
The goal is not only to lift the breasts but also to create natural harmony with the patient’s body.
Breast Shape Changes During Recovery
Immediately after surgery, breasts may appear:
- Higher than expected
- Firmer
- Tighter
- Less natural
This occurs because of:
- Swelling
- Skin tension
- Healing tissues
Over time, breasts usually become softer and more natural.
Breast Shape Timeline After Mastopexy
First Few Weeks
Patients may notice:
- Tight breasts
- High breast position
- Swelling
- Uneven appearance
These changes are usually temporary.
Three to Six Months
Breasts begin to:
- Settle
- Soften
- Develop a more natural contour
One Year After Surgery
The final breast shape becomes clearer as:
- Scars mature
- Tissue stabilizes
- Swelling resolves
Common Breast Shape Concerns After Mastopexy
Flat Breasts After Lift
Some patients feel their breasts look flatter after surgery.
Possible reasons include:
- Removal of excess skin without adding volume
- Loss of breast tissue volume
- Lack of upper pole fullness
A breast lift mainly reshapes and lifts existing tissue but does not significantly increase breast size.
Boxy Breasts After Lift
Some patients notice a square or box-like breast appearance.
This may occur due to:
- Tight skin closure
- Limited lower breast fullness
- Early healing changes
In many cases, the shape improves as tissues relax.
Loss of Upper Breast Fullness
A breast lift may improve position but may not restore fullness in the upper breast area.
Patients seeking more fullness may consider:
- Breast implants
- Fat grafting
Breasts Looking Smaller After Lift
Breasts may appear smaller because:
- Excess skin has been removed
- Sagging tissue has been repositioned
- Breast shape becomes more compact

Breast Shape After Lift Without Implants
Benefits of Breast Lift Alone
A breast lift without implants can provide:
- Natural breast appearance
- Improved breast position
- Reduced sagging
It is suitable for patients who want:
- A lifted look
- No additional volume
Limitations of Lift Without Implants
A lift alone may not provide:
- Significant upper fullness
- Larger breast size
- Rounder projection
Patients expecting fuller breasts may require additional procedures.
Breast Shape After Lift With Implants
Benefits of Combining Lift and Implants
A breast lift with implants may improve:
- Upper breast fullness
- Projection
- Roundness
Possible Concerns
Some patients may experience:
- Implant-related asymmetry
- Tight appearance
- Excessive roundness
- Implant position issues
Proper implant selection and surgical planning are important.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does breast shape change after mastopexy?
Yes. Breasts continue changing as swelling decreases and tissues settle.
Why do my breasts look flat after a lift?
A lift improves position but does not always restore lost volume.
Can boxy breasts after lift become rounder?
Some improvement occurs naturally, but persistent concerns may require revision.
Is a breast lift without implants enough for fullness?
It depends on existing breast tissue and desired results.
